HPI Racing Savage XL Specifications

General IconGeneral
Vehicle TypeMonster Truck
Scale1/8
Fuel TypeNitro
Drive System4WD
Radio System2.4GHz
DifferentialBevel Gear
ChassisAluminum
BodyPolycarbonate
Wheelbase390mm (15 inches)
Transmission2-Speed
